Reporting to the Home Value & Growth Segment Lead, the Home Strategic Amplification & Regional Growth Manager will support in turning approved Home priorities into regionally relevant, partner-enabled and community-led execution that grows penetration, trust, adoption and portfolio value.
The role unlocks Regions as a Home value and growth pool by converting national Home priorities into local market opportunities, estate routes, community activations, dealer ecosystems, partner showcases and measurable commercial outcomes.
Using micro-segmentation, household personas and regional insight, the role turns Home growth missions into local execution plays that mobilize Regions, estates, communities, retail routes, digital channels, developers, property managers, partners and frontline teams to move households from awareness to qualification, installation, activation, repeat usage, Smart Living attach, Financial Services adoption, loyalty participation and retention.

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in Business, Marketing, Insights, Commercial, Digital, Communications, Telecommunications or a related field.
- Minimum 4 years’ experience in a sales or trade marketing, with demonstrated expertise in regional commercial activation, customer acquisition and retention, channel and ecosystem stakeholder management and strategic partnerships.Â
- Practical experience in marketing execution, regional activation, partnerships, customer engagement, home broadband, CVM, customer value management or go-to-market support.
- Good understanding of customer insight, household personas, regional execution, community engagement, Home propositions, Financial Services attach, loyalty, developers, property ecosystems and partner networks.
- Ability to prepare briefs, track actions, coordinate stakeholders and support execution across Regions, Brand, Product, Home, Network, CVM, Financial Services, Care, Technology and partners.
- Strong communication, follow-through, organization and willingness to learn in a fast-moving matrix environment.
